Captain Smart’s Distressing Ordeal and Divine Intervention

Ghanaian Broadcaster Blessed Godsbrain Smart, known as Captain Smart, recently disclosed a distressing ordeal he experienced during a bus journey, where a heavenly intervention played a crucial role in their rescue. The incident involved him and gospel musician Jack Alolome as they were traveling from Agona-Swedru to Achimota for a crusade.

The Unfortunate Incident

Captain Smart detailed that while they were seated in the bus, it suddenly switched to free gear, rendering the driver unable to control the vehicle. Seated in the middle seat, he witnessed the driver’s mate take off a ring, chant on it, and put it back on. Meanwhile, gospel musician Jack Alolome raised a song in Twi, emphasizing divine protection during the unsettling situation.

Divine Intervention

As the bus continued its erratic journey, they reached a town where a fellow passenger used a stone to stop the vehicle. Captain Smart acknowledged the divine intervention, attributing the miraculous stopping of the bus to God’s intervention.

The Unusual Encounter

Following the bus’s halt, a barefooted and shirtless man approached them, inquiring about the stone used to stop the vehicle. In response, Jack Alolome stood up to defend the passengers, demonstrating his faith in God.

Confirmation by Jack Alolome

Jack Alolome later confirmed the incident during an appearance on the Onua Maakye show, corroborating Captain Smart’s account of the distressing bus journey and the divine intervention that ensured their safety.
